Square off against Meaning in English
expression
परिभाषा
To prepare to fight, compete, or have a direct confrontation with someone, usually as opponents.
उपयोग और बारीकियां
Mainly informal and common in sports, debates, or any competition. Implies a face-to-face, often tense confrontation. Sometimes used for both literal physical fights and figurative rivalry. Usually followed by the name of the opponent: 'square off against someone'.
